In a country where damaged roads and bridges can quickly isolate communities, disrupt trade and complicate humanitarian and security operations, Burkina Faso is turning to an increasingly important form of infrastructure resilience: bridges that can move when the roads cannot.
The West African country is training 120 Burkinabè technicians and personnel to deploy Unibridge mobile bridges, an initiative aimed at ensuring that the collapse or destruction of a critical crossing does not necessarily become a prolonged interruption to movement.
The trainees have been drawn from the Ministry of Construction, the military engineering corps and Faso Mêbo, a national initiative involved in infrastructure development. Their training covers the practical skills required to assemble, dismantle, maintain and operationally deploy the mobile bridge systems.
The significance goes beyond the technology itself.
For Burkina Faso, the initiative represents an effort to build domestic technical capacity capable of responding to infrastructure emergencies without having to depend entirely on external expertise.
When a bridge goes down, connectivity can disappear
Across Africa, bridges are more than concrete and steel structures. They are lifelines connecting farming communities to markets, patients to health facilities, children to schools and regions to national economies.
When a major bridge is washed away, damaged or rendered unusable, the consequences can extend far beyond the immediate physical destruction.
Transport costs rise. Agricultural produce can spoil. Emergency services face delays. Commercial activity slows. In remote areas, communities can effectively become isolated.
Mobile bridging technology offers a different proposition: restore connectivity first, rebuild permanently later.
Rather than waiting months for conventional reconstruction, trained teams can establish a temporary crossing to restore circulation while longer-term engineering works are undertaken.
Burkina Faso bets on skills, not only equipment
During a visit to the National School of Public Works, Construction Minister Mikaïlou Sidibé underscored the importance of transferring the knowledge required to operate and maintain the technology to Burkinabè personnel.
That emphasis is critical.
Infrastructure resilience is not created simply by purchasing sophisticated equipment. It depends on whether a country has the engineers, technicians and institutions capable of deploying, maintaining and adapting that equipment when an emergency occurs.
By training personnel from civilian construction institutions, military engineers and Faso Mêbo, Burkina Faso is effectively creating a pool of specialists who can potentially respond across different operational environments.
The approach also brings together capabilities that are often treated separately: civil engineering, military engineering and national infrastructure mobilisation.
A bridge for emergencies; and a broader development strategy
The mobile bridge programme arrives at a time when Burkina Faso is seeking to strengthen its ability to maintain essential infrastructure amid significant pressures on the country’s transport networks.
Its value, therefore, may extend beyond disaster response.
A mobile bridge can potentially become an instrument of economic continuity; allowing trucks, buses, farmers, traders and emergency vehicles to continue moving even when permanent infrastructure has been compromised.
For landlocked Burkina Faso, where road connectivity is central to domestic commerce and access to neighbouring markets, that resilience carries strategic importance.
The initiative also reflects a broader question confronting African countries: How much of the continent’s infrastructure resilience can be built from within?
For decades, major infrastructure projects across Africa have often relied heavily on foreign contractors, imported technology and external technical expertise. Burkina Faso’s decision to invest in specialised domestic training points towards a different model; one in which technology is acquired, but the knowledge to operate it is deliberately retained and developed locally.
The bigger lesson for Africa
The real test will come when the technology is needed in an actual emergency.
A mobile bridge sitting in storage is only equipment. A trained team capable of transporting it to a damaged crossing, assembling it safely and restoring traffic within a short period is a national resilience asset.
That distinction is at the heart of Burkina Faso’s initiative.
The training of 120 personnel may therefore appear modest against the scale of the country’s infrastructure needs, but it represents an important principle: resilient infrastructure is not only about building stronger roads and bridges; it is also about building the human capacity to keep societies connected when those structures fail.
As climate-related extreme weather, conflict, ageing infrastructure and rapid urbanisation increasingly test transport networks across Africa, the ability to restore connectivity quickly could become just as important as the ability to construct permanent infrastructure.
For Burkina Faso, the mobile bridge is consequently more than a temporary crossing. It is a statement of preparedness — and an investment in the idea that when a road ends unexpectedly, the country’s ability to keep moving should not end with it.
